Final Year Student Allegedly Shot Dead By Gunmen In Kogi (Photo) by 247naijamedia: 11:46am On Dec 11, 2019
A final year student of Kogi State University identified as Joseph Apeh was allegedly shot dead by unknown gunmen after concluding his examination yesterday December 10.

The deceased who was allegedly gunned down after being trailed to the campus, was a final year student in the Department of English at the Kogi State University (KSU), Anyigba. The gunmen that reportedly shot him at close range, rode on a motorcycle.

Joseph Apeh was confirmed dead after being rushed to Kogi State University Hospital.
